#3 Goal vs Tottenham – 2015 League Cup final
Playing in the League Cup final against cross-town rivals Tottenham, Chelsea were precariously hanging on to a 1 goal lead with the Spurs threatening to mark their ascension in the Premier League with a comeback in the second half. Diego Costa put paid to those concerns with a goal deflected in off Kyle Walker – originally credited to him as an own goal but later confirmed as Costa’s on the official League Cup website – that gave the Blues their first major trophy in two years & the confidence to push on & win the league title as well.
